Analysis of Movement and Actions of Wingers as Second-Line Players in Organized Attack in Handball

Dimitris Hatzimanouil,
Jose M. Saavedra,
Afroditi Lola
et al.

Abstract: In modern handball, one of the important performance indicators is the effectiveness of the attack, especially the running-in of wingers as line players which has not been explored adequately. The purpose of the study was to analyze the movements of wingers in the organized attack when they run in. Fifty-eight matches were analyzed from the 2022 EHF European Men’s Handball Championship.
